About the Role
The Maintenance Planner position, located in Selma, AL, is a full-time onsite role crucial for upholding efficient and safe plant operations. The successful candidate will plan, prioritize, and coordinate maintenance tasks to support reliable production. This involves preventive and predictive maintenance scheduling, managing the Computerized Maintenance Management System (CMMS), tracking key performance indicators (KPIs), and ensuring availability of tools, materials, and resources.
Key Duties and Responsibilities
- Evaluate maintenance requests and define detailed scopes of work.
- Create comprehensive job plans specifying labor, materials, tools, and expected durations.
- Assign priorities to work orders considering safety implications, urgency, and production impact.
- Synchronize maintenance schedules with operations to optimize planned downtimes.
- Verify availability of necessary parts, tools, and equipment prior to executing jobs.
- Generate, maintain, and update work orders within the CMMS system.
- Monitor supplier deliveries, documentation, and track inventory movements.
- Maintain accurate records related to maintenance activities.
- Analyze daily maintenance KPIs such as downtime and equipment availability to inform improvement plans.
- Create MVP system work orders based on maintenance needs identified.
- Contribute to continuous improvement initiatives and uphold 5S workplace organization standards.
